6401 CROSS KEYS BLVD. CRESTWOOD, KY 40014 PHONE: 502-243-8282

Trijicon MRO Slip on Anti-Reflection Device

Article number: TRIAC31018
Availability: In stock

Features a durable ARD (anti-reflective device) for shielding the forward light emission of the lens and for protecting the objective lens of the Trijicon MRO.

0 stars based on 0 reviews